Holland America Line has teamed up with Back in Time for Bed (BITFB), a support network that helps working parents in the travel industry, to host its first family ship visit in the UK.
The event will take place on 3 April on board Rotterdam in Southampton, from 10am-2pm, and there are 75 places up for grabs.
Attendees will be able to experience a range of activities, including a preview of the on-board Kids’ Club, which features three programmes for different age groups.
A scavenger hunt will give families the chance to explore the ship together and win Easter prizes. There will be the option of lunch at the ship’s Lido Market, Dive In Burger or New York Pizza and Deli.
BITFB was launched in February 2023 by Riviera Travel Director of Trade and Partnerships in the UK and Ireland Vicky Billing and Panache Cruises Chief Commercial Officer Anna Perrott.
